Output dd774c9717aa6bf0abd7a36ddd4653eeaa8acdcb0784c2d74c4b6c551cf9d006:47

value
268817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e51491ac6345c151a74bc748e00e7db2ea0a2c8 OP_EQUAL
address
3EfXFbyCFrnsFFqfXTTpV8tsGPeNxHQ9i8
transaction
dd774c9717aa6bf0abd7a36ddd4653eeaa8acdcb0784c2d74c4b6c551cf9d006
spent
true